Ann Lindsey Burgess, 83, of Memphis, died peacefully on July 16, 2015. She was born October 16, 1931, in Banner, the daughter of Boyce Lindsey and Addie Chloe Riley McMahan. She graduated from Memphis Technical High School in 1949 and retired from The University of Memphis after 35 years of loyal service, where she was honored for her work with students for whom she provided vocational placement and guidance. A member of First Baptist on East Parkway North since 1951, she was a faithful Sunday school member, Sarah Cunningham’s right hand person, and an active participant in Baptist Women. She loved to volunteer her time in the church office and was known as an avid, die hard, Ole Miss Rebel.
She was preceded in death by her brother Sonny Lindsey, and sister Nina Jo Lindsey McMahan. She was survived by her husband of 66 years, Bruce Burgess; sister Delores Sherrill, Madison, and numerous nieces, nephews and cousins.
